The Impact of Bonus Multipliers

The inclusion of bonus multipliers substantially alters the risk-reward profile of the game. A large multiplier attached to a specific combination can dramatically increase potential winnings, tempting players to prioritize that outcome. However, these multipliers are often associated with lower probabilities, meaning players must weigh the allure of a significant payout against the increased likelihood of failing to achieve the combination. A savvy player will analyze the multiplier’s value in relation to the difficulty of achieving the corresponding number pattern. The principle of expected value becomes essential: a large multiplier on an almost impossible combination offers a lower expected return than a smaller multiplier on a significantly more probable result. Skillful players are able to calculate these probabilities and adapt their tactics accordingly.

Number Combination
Probability of Occurrence
Multiplier
Expected Value
Simple Line (Horizontal, Vertical, Diagonal) 0.15 2x 0.30
Four Corners 0.08 5x 0.40
Full Card 0.01 100x 1.00
Specific Pattern (e.g., 'T' Shape) 0.10 3x 0.30

This table illustrates how, even with significantly higher multipliers, lower probability events might not always yield the highest expected value. Players should always factor in these values when formulating their strategy.

The Psychological Aspects of Gameplay

Beyond the mathematical and statistical considerations, the psychological aspects of these number-matching games play a significant role in determining success. Maintaining composure under pressure, avoiding emotional decision-making, and recognizing the inherent randomness of the game are crucial for long-term profitability. It’s easy to become frustrated when numbers don’t align with your expectations, but allowing those emotions to cloud your judgment can lead to costly mistakes. Disciplined players adhere to their pre-defined strategies, resisting the urge to chase losses or deviate from their risk tolerance. Recognizing the ‘gambler’s fallacy’ – the belief that past events influence future independent events – is particularly important in these types of games. Each number draw is independent of previous draws, so attempting to predict future outcomes based on past patterns is a flawed strategy.
